Explanation:
#include <iostream>
using namespace std;
//class definition
class Numbers
{
private:
int a;
int b;
public:
//member function declaration
void readNumbers(void);
void printNumbers(void);
int calAddition(void);
};
//member function definitions
void Numbers::readNumbers(void)
{
cout<<“Enter first number: “;
cin>>a;
cout<<“Enter second number: “;
cin>>b;
}
void Numbers::printNumbers(void)
{
cout<<“a= “<<a<<“,b= “<<b<<endl;
}
int Numbers::calAddition(void)
{
return (a+b);
}
//main function
int main()
{
//declaring object
Numbers num;
int add; //variable to store addition
//take input
num.readNumbers();
//find addition
add=num.calAddition();
//print numbers
num.printNumbers();
//print addition
cout<<“Addition/sum= “<<add<<endl;
return 0;
}
